Former India captain Virender Sehwag said that he is not impressed with the captaincy of Rajasthan Royals captain Ryan Parag in IPL 2026.

After losing to Gujarat Titans in Qualifier 2 on Friday, Parag has led RR to third place this year. GT will now play defending champions and table-topper Royal Challengers Bangalore in the IPL final on Sunday.

Parag was appointed the full-time captain of RR for this IPL season after taking charge in 8 out of 14 matches last year due to injury to regular captain Sanju Samson.

Samson was then transferred to Chennai Super Kings, with Ravindra Jadeja and Sam Curran coming from the “Yellow Army”.

Rajasthan Royals in IPL 2026

After the disappointment of finishing 9th in IPL 2025, RR managed to bounce back in IPL 2026. The team won each of its first four matches in the tournament before a temporary decline.

After a four-match winning streak, Riyan Parag’s team lost six of its eight matches. Parag could not play even two matches this year due to injuries.

With qualification on the line, RR pulled themselves together and won their last two matches to cement their place as the fourth team in the top four on the points table.

Like the rest of the season, RR relied on the individual brilliance of Vaibhav Suryavanshi and Jofra Archer in the playoffs. Suryavanshi scored 97 runs in just 29 balls and Archer took three wickets in the powerplay against SRH in the eliminator.

RR reached Qualifier 2, but this time it was a different challenge. Suryavanshi made 96 this time, but the support was minimal. However, Shubman Gill’s century sent RR home and took GT to their third final in just five years as a franchise.

‘He has no contribution as captain’-Sehwag

Virender Sehwag spoke to Cricbuzz and said that he did not think Parag was a particularly reactive captain. Sehwag said that RR’s success was based on some impressive individual contributions, but Parag never took any proactive decisions.

As a captain he has not impressed me much. If one of your individual players does something extraordinary, you win the match. But he had no contribution as captain. They did not play the right players in the middle order. If you are not reactive to bowling changes and field placements, it becomes difficult to make a comeback.

Virender Sehwag said, “I didn’t feel that Riyan Parag talked to any particular bowler or used anyone at the time when wickets could have been taken. I don’t think you can become a better captain just by playing tricks.”

Riyan Parag in IPL 2026

Despite playing important middle-order roles at No. 4 and 5 this year, Riyan Parag’s returns with the bat have been quiet.

His playing in the last few matches due to injury could be a reason. Riyan Parag has scored only 309 runs in 14 matches at an average of 23.76 and strike rate of 157. He also scored two half-centuries.
